摘要: 1.字符串的不可变性 当年给一个字符串重新赋值之后,老值并没有被销毁,而是开辟一块新空间存储新值: 当程序结束后,GC扫描整个内存,如果发现有的空间没有被指向,则立即把它销毁。 2.我们可以将字符串看作是char类型的一个只读数组 ToCharArray();将字符串转换成Char数组; new s 阅读全文
posted @ 2022-09-23 14:19 ZerryLuo 阅读(26) 评论(0) 推荐(0) 编辑
摘要: public:公开的 private:私有的 protected:受保护的,只能在当前类的内部以及该类的子类中访问 internal:只能在当前程序集中访问,在同一个项目中,internal和public的权限是一样的 需要注意的点: 子类的访问权限不能高于父类的访问权限,否则会暴露父类中的成员 阅读全文
posted @ 2022-09-23 11:23 ZerryLuo 阅读(27) 评论(0) 推荐(0) 编辑
摘要: public class BaseRepository<T> : IBaseRepository<T> where T : class, new() { protected SqlSugarClient db => GetInstance(); protected virtual SqlSugarC 阅读全文
posted @ 2022-09-23 11:19 ZerryLuo 阅读(200) 评论(0) 推荐(0) 编辑
摘要: IsPrimaryKey = true:设置为主键 IsIdentity = true:自增列(注意要和数据库保持一致,将数据库中的列设为自增列即可) 注意:当你的主键是Guid类型时,只需设置IsPrimaryKey = true即可 阅读全文
posted @ 2022-09-23 10:55 ZerryLuo 阅读(1499) 评论(0) 推荐(0) 编辑
摘要: 步骤: 1.右键字段所在的表,点击设计 2.点击需要修改的列名,查看下面的属性栏 3.找到标识规范,下拉 4,将”是标识“改为是,点击保存即可。 5.可能有的同学会弹出以下弹窗 我们只需找到”工具=>选项“ 打开选项,找到设计器,将”阻止保存要求重新创建表的更改“前面的勾取消掉,然后重复3、4步骤即 阅读全文
posted @ 2022-09-23 10:24 ZerryLuo 阅读(1675) 评论(0) 推荐(0) 编辑